Caroline Inker is a counsel in the firm’s Tax Department. She advises on a broad range of U.K. and international corporate, financing and structuring transactions with a particular focus on the financial sector, mergers and acquisitions, corporate financings, restructurings and other corporate transactions.

Some of Caroline’s most recent experience includes:

  • CK Hutchison on the €10 billion sale of its large portfolio of telecommunications towers assets in Europe to Cellnex
  • Altaris Capital Partners on its acquisition of Johnson Matthey’s health division
  • Ardian Infrastructure on its $575 million acquisition of Verne Global
  • CK Infrastructure on the disposal of a 25% interest in Northumbria Water to KKR
  • PricewaterhouseCoopers as administrators and liquidators in relation to the global insolvency of the Lehman group
  • Cerberus in relation to the tax structuring and implementation of a series of highly complex securitisation refinancings and restructurings
  • Green Investment Group (part of Macquarie) on the sale of interests in four UK energy from waste facilities to EQT
  • Ontario Teachers’ Pension Plan on the acquisition of the Memora Group
  • A leading financial institution on the purchase of a $1.6 billion stake in an offshore windfarm
  • QIA on numerous investments across Europe and Asia
